The monthly vendor market, Shop & Grub, returns to Naftzger Park in April

Calling all shoppers! Shop & Grub is back. If you’ve never heard of the event, it’s a monthly market put on by Festive ICT that features a variety of unique vendors selling vintage clothing, jewelry, accessories, home goods, wine, pastries, delicious food and more.

Located at Naftzger Park at 601 E. Douglas, it’s right in the middle of the city, making it a convenient stop for everybody.

The market also includes a bar provided by Wave, music by DJ Magnum & Marcobiotics and an overall great atmosphere. Best of all, admission is free to the public.

Here is the 2022 Shop & Grub schedule:
April 24th: 11am-4pm (4th Sunday) – Season Opener May 15th 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day)
June 19th: 9am-2pm (3rd Sunday Father’s Day edition) July 17th 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day)
August 21st: 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day)
September 18th: 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day)
October 16th: 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day)
November 20th: 11am-4pm (3rd Sunday) – Last market of the season
